The Dancers (1958) by Ernst Wilhelm Nay: A Modernist Masterpiece on Aluminum

Experience the dynamic energy of Ernst Wilhelm Nay's "The Dancers" (1958) in a museum-quality aluminum print from RedKalion. This iconic work from Nay's late period captures the rhythmic abstraction of movement, blending geometric forms with expressive color fields to evoke the vitality of dance. As a leading figure in post-war German abstraction, Nay pioneered a unique visual language that transcends figurative representation, making this piece a cornerstone of modernist art history.

What is the historical significance of Ernst Wilhelm Nay's "The Dancers" (1958)?

"The Dancers" (1958) represents Ernst Wilhelm Nay's late abstract period, where he explored rhythmic forms and color fields to evoke movement, reflecting post-war German modernism and his influence on abstract expressionism.
